[REQUEST] BIOS unlocked HP DV7-5000er
#1
Good day. There is an old laptop HP Pavilion dv7-5000er
https://support.hp.com/en-us/drivers/sel...el/5046705
last bios - https://ftp.hp.com/pub/softpaq/sp54001-5...p54077.exe
Due to the fact that the discrete graphics card is always on, it overheats.
I would like to disable it and leave it only integrated into the processor. What I tried to do:
1. from the site https://www.bios-mods.com/BIOS/index.php?dir=Insyde%2F
downloaded file https://www.bios-mods.com/BIOS/index.php...miloml.exe
an extended menu appeared in the BIOS, but I did not see there an item for turning off the discrete video card and after saving the BIOS the laptop does not start until i take out the battery.
2. tried to make Access Advanced settings through EFI shell, but could not start the UEFI shell, it does not start from a USB disk - it hangs. Clover - crashes with error 0xF

Has anyone encountered such a laptop and modified the BIOS?
